you have Virtual Boy is it good? hwo do you use it? put gogles on then play? like you dont need a TV?
virtual boy is its own headset--you just kind of hunch over and stick your head into it while it strobes annoying red images from one eye to the other very quickly. The flashing and hunching is rather painful, but I find that the neck pain is lessened by playing it laying on your back with the "knees" of the bipod on my chest.
Still, no matter what you do, it gets to be extremely painful for long periods, so RPG's are out. :lol: but it's generally worth the trouble--it's a unique gaming sensation. Since it's one of my easier systems to list, I'll even name my games:
